SUNY Old Westbury is a four-year, public school located in Old Westbury, New York. It offers 4 health profession degree programs. By offered degree types, SUNY Old Westbury have 2 bachelor's degree programs, and 2 graduate programs for the health profession degrees.

The 2025 undergraduate tuition & fees of SUNY Old Westbury is $8,372 for New York residents and $18,842 for out-of-state students. For graduate programs, the SUNY Old Westbury's graduate tuition & fees is $12,314 for New York residents and $24,794 for out-of-state students.

Last year, total 63 students have completed their health profession studies. 46 students earned the bachelor's degrees.

The acceptance rate at SUNY Old Westbury is 83.63% and the graduation rate is 45%. The students to faculty ratio is 17 to 1 and the retention rate is 72%.
